A UN report reveals India’s declining fertility rate alongside barriers to reproductive freedom, creating a “high-low duality.” While some states grapple with unintended pregnancies due to limited access and gender norms, others face below-replacement fertility driven by financial constraints and work-life conflicts. The focus should shift to fulfilling reproductive goals by empowering individuals to make informed choices.
